Stock market review: FBN Holdings leads 41 others as investors gain N811bnFBN Holdings Plc has topped 41 other advanced equities to pull the Nigerian Exchange Ltd.(NGX) market indices up by 1.46 per cent, week-on-week, making investors gain N811 billion.

Nigerian Equities Market Sees Negative Returns Amidst Global Stock Market DownturnFollowing the recent increase in the benchmark interest rate by the Central Bank of Nigeria, the Nigerian equities market has experienced three consecutive weeks of negative returns. This decline is in line with the global stock market trend, as geopolitical crisis and rising oil prices have dampened investors' appetite. While major stock indices in the US, UK, Japan, and Europe have all declined, China's SSE Index has seen a slight increase.
